Best Protein Bars
I can’t recommend the best protein bar. You will have to do some label comparisons to determine what bar on the market is best for you. I can tell you that a lot of the protein bars out there are very high in both calories and fat content, as well as sugars since sugar will give you a temporary energy burst. There are several categories of protein bars:
• Healthy protein snack
• Meal replacement
• Body building
You can find protein bars with a fat level as high as 50 percent. What you want to look for are bars with high levels of protein and fiber and low levels of carbs with less than 15 grams of sugar. For weight loss purposes look for 280 calories or less, 25 grams of carbs or less, 25 grams or protein or more and at least 3 to 5 grams of fiber or more. Also compare vitamins and minerals. Rule out bars with hydrogenated fats and palm oil. Last, but important, you will want to find a bar that tastes good. Whey Protein Bars
Protein Bars
Protein bars usually contain a protein powder, usually a soy protein or a whey protein. Whey is a by- product of milk and is considered the best type of protein powder. I did find an article about a study of the two types on men working on bodybuilding. In this study, Soy protein was found to have several advantages. For women, especially those attempting to lose weight by replacing meals with protein bars, whey protein seems to be recommended the most. When looking at protein bar labels, you will find two types of whey protein listed. Whey isolate is 90 per cent whey protein. Whey protein concentrate contains 29 to 89 percent fats and lactose. Most bars have a combination of the two.

Low Carb Protein Bars
When protein bars first came on the market, they often contained high carbs, mostly simple carbs and low in complex carbs. With people now being so aware of carbohydrate intake, producers of protein bars have begun marketing bars with moderate carb ingredients. Most bars contain oatmeal, wheat germ, and nuts along with various dried fruits to accompany the protein
